The IPL has unveiled its retention rules, allowing franchises to keep up to six players through direct retention or Right to Match options. Teams must submit their final list by October 31, 2024. A new ‘pay more to retain more’ policy affects the auction purse, with specific costs associated with retaining capped and uncapped players.
